Missouri lands commitment from Texas running back
Three-star running back Darius Anderson committed to Missouri Saturday, according to his Twitter account.

The 5-10, 185-pound Rosenberg, Tx., native is rated as the country’s No. 34 running back and the No. 79 overall player in the state of Texas.
Anderson rushed for 2,677 yards and 26 touchdowns during his sophomore and junior seasons. He became Missouri’s 13th commitment for the class of 2016.
